Multifocal Torpedo Maculopathy Complicated by Choroidal Neovascularization.
Maria Camila Castro1, Tianyu Liu2, Antonio Capone2
1Oakland University William Beaumont School of Medicine, Rochester, MI, USA.
A pediatric patient with torpedo maculopathy experienced choroidal neovascularization (CNV). Treatment with ranibizumab injections successfully regressed the CNV and improved vision, highlighting a rare complication in children.
